Malai Kofta

Malai Kofta

Ingredients:

For kofta:

Boiled potato             – 1  cup peeled and grated
Shredded paneer        – 1 cup
Shredded carrot          -1
frozen peas                 -3 tbsp.
green beans                 – 4 finely chopped
coriander powder        -1 tsp
cumin powder              -1/2 tsp
chilli powder                -1 tsp
corn flour                      – 1/4 cup
salt                                 – to taste
oil                                  – to deep fry

For curry:

onion                          -11/2 medium
cashews                      -8-10 whole
tomato                        -3
whole garam               -to temper
cumin seeds                 -1 tsp
ginger garlic paste       -11/2 tsp
coriander powder         -1 tbsp
cumin powder              -1/2 tbsp.
chilli powder                -11/2 tsp
heavy cream                 -1/4 -1/2 cup
salt                                -to taste
oil                                  -1 tbsp
cilantro                         -to garnish

Method:

For Koftas:

  • Micro wave finely chopped beans, peas and shredded carrots with 1/2 tsp of water for 3-4 minutes

  • Mash it with a spoon.(if u  do not use a  micro wave then boil it in water and squeeze out all the excess liquid)
  • In a bowl mix grated potato, paneer, mashed vegetables with salt, coriander powder, chilli powder, cumin powder and a tbsp. of corn flour.

  • Make it into equal sized koftas and roll it over on plate with corn flour and keep it aside.

  • Heat oil for frying.
  • Fry the koftas in oil until golden(these koftas are so delicate so handle carefully that it should not break)

For curry:

  • In a pan heat little oil and temper with whole garam
  • Now fry cashews and cubed onions in it until  golden.

  • Mix the ginger garlic paste and tomatoes to it.

  • After a minute put all the spice powders to it along with desired salt.

  • Cook until mushy and switch off the stove.

  • Allow it to cool down and blend it into a fine paste.
  • In  a kadai add little oil and temper with cumin seeds.

  • Now pour the blended mixture to it mix well and add a cup and 1/4 of water.

  • When it starts boiling add the fresh cream to it and cook for few more minutes.

  • Garnish with cilantro.
  • When ready to serve arrange the koftas in serving bowl and pour the  curry over it .

  • It tastes awesome with ghee Rice/Naan/chapathi
Serves 4-6
